The producer of the Marvel Cinematic Universe movie “Black Panther: Wakanda Forever” Nate Moore said its antagonist Namor will not have its standalone film.

Namor destroys Wakanda to fulfil his political agenda in “Black Panther: Wakanda Forever“. Shuri (Letitia Wright) spared Namor’s life after he killed Queen Ramonda (Angela Bassett) because they wanted to protect their people.

It is assumed that the character will return in future Marvel web shows and movies because of the film’s ending. Marvel Studios and Universal Pictures had struck a deal where they agreed that Namor will only appear for marketing reasons.

Nate Moore has had to make big changes regarding Namor’s character arc.

“It honestly affects us more, and not to talk too much out of school, but in how we market the film than it does how we use him in the film,” he said.

“There weren’t really things we couldn’t do from a character perspective for him, which is good because clearly, we took a ton of inspiration from the source material, but we also made some big changes to really anchor him in that world in a truth that publishing never really landed on, I would argue, in a big way.”
